Content

Objective

Giving basic computer competences to students in order to be enable them to use computer programs effectively and systematically,
basic hardware, operating system and office applications, especially excel and graphics processing programs.

Course Content

1. Computer History
2. Hardware and Peripherals
3. Computer Operating Systems
4. Computer Networks and the Internet
5. Word Processing Programs
6. Word Processing Programs
7. Presentation Programs
Midterm Exam
9. Account Tables
10. Account Tables
11. Vector Based Graphics Processing Programs
12. Vector Based Graphics Processing Programs
13. Pixel Based Graphics Processing Programs
14. Page Editing Programs
